OpenVoice

Private voice dictation for Mac - polished by on-device AI

Local-first voice dictation for macOS. Hold a hotkey, speak, and your words are typed into any app - cognato-ai/openvoice

Hey Product Hunt 👋 I built OpenVoice because I wanted WisprFlow-style dictation without sending my voice to someone else's servers. How it works: hold a hotkey, talk, and your words land in whatever app you're in -- Slack, Mail, your editor, anywhere. Everything runs on your Mac. What makes it different: 🔒 Fully on-device. Transcription and cleanup both run locally (Whisper/Parakeet + a tiny local LLM). No cloud, no account, nothing leaves your machine. ✨ It cleans up what you said. Not just raw transcription - a local model removes filler words, fixes punctuation, and adapts to the app: a casual message in Slack, a proper email in Mail, bullet notes in a notes app. 🎛️ Yours to control. 65 speech models to choose from, adjustable rewrite levels, custom prompts, and per-app auto-styling. Runs offline. 🆓 Free and open source. One heads-up: I don't have an Apple Developer account yet, so the app isn't notarized. On first launch, macOS will warn you — right-click the app → Open (or allow it under System Settings → Privacy & Security) to get past Gatekeeper. Because it's unsigned, you'll also need to re-grant Microphone and Accessibility permissions after each update. An Apple-signed build is on the roadmap — being open source, you can also build it yourself from source in the meantime. OpenVoice was hunted by Harsh Soni. A “hunter” on Product Hunt is the community member who submits a product to the platform — uploading the images, the link, and tagging the makers behind it. Hunters typically write the first comment explaining why a product is worth attention, and their followers are notified the moment they post. Around 79% of featured launches on Product Hunt are self-hunted by their makers, but a well-known hunter still acts as a signal of quality to the rest of the community.
